element-web/test/components/views
ElementRobot 877fa9c5c4
Fix progress bar regression throughout the app (#9219) (#9221)
* Fix useSmoothAnimation enablement not working properly by getting rid of it

Passing duration=0 is more logical and less superfluous

* Refactor UploadBar to handle state more correctly

* Change ProgressBar to new useSmoothAnimation signature and default animated to true for consistency

* Add type guard

* Make types stricter

* Write tests for the ProgressBar component

* Make the new test conform to tsc --strict

* Update UploadBar.tsx

* Update UploadBar.tsx

* Update UploadBar.tsx

(cherry picked from commit 9b99c967f4)

Co-authored-by: Michael Telatynski <7t3chguy@gmail.com>
2022-08-25 16:47:48 +01:00
..
audio_messages Update matrix-org/react (enzyme deprecation) (#9116) 2022-08-02 15:10:43 +02:00
beacon make beacon events more specific (#9186) 2022-08-16 10:23:25 +02:00
context_menus Fix context menu being opened when clicking message action bar buttons (#9200) 2022-08-18 09:18:18 +02:00
dialogs Device Manager - add new labsed session manager screen (PSG-636) (#9119) 2022-08-08 13:51:00 +00:00
elements Fix progress bar regression throughout the app (#9219) (#9221) 2022-08-25 16:47:48 +01:00
location Move pin drop out of labs (PSG-664) (#9135) 2022-08-08 10:57:38 +02:00
messages Fix context menu being opened when clicking message action bar buttons (#9200) 2022-08-18 09:18:18 +02:00
right_panel Update matrix-org/react (enzyme deprecation) (#9116) 2022-08-02 15:10:43 +02:00
rooms Hide sticker picker for local rooms (#9174) 2022-08-11 17:51:24 +02:00
settings Device manager - expandable session details in device list (PSG-644) (#9188) 2022-08-17 11:58:34 +02:00
spaces Update matrix-org/react (enzyme deprecation) (#9116) 2022-08-02 15:10:43 +02:00
typography Eslint - require copyright header rule (#8514) 2022-05-06 09:09:28 +00:00
voip Update matrix-org/react (enzyme deprecation) (#9116) 2022-08-02 15:10:43 +02:00